Osteria Morini

"For me, the broth is quintessentially the expression of the dish," Iron Chef Mario Batali explains of tortellini en brodo, which a hearty, warming Italian soup he likes to order from New York City hot spot Osteria Morini. He's also a fan of the hearty gramigna pasta with meat sauce (pictured above). This slow-cooked ragu boasts pork sausage and a splash of cream, and it's rounded out with bold garlicky oil just before serving.

Wise Sons Jewish Delicatessen

Take it from Chef Eric Greenspan: "The reuben brings together everything you look for in a sandwich." This meaty creation (pictured above) is stacked with moist, succulent pastrami, tender sauerkraut and Swiss cheese, and is just one of the deli favorites he indulges in while visit San Francisco's Wise Sons restaurant. He also likes an old-school bialy dressed up with cream cheese, silky lox and salty capers, saying, "What makes this combination special is the simplicity."

The Greek

"When I go to dinner," Iron Chef Bobby Flay explains, "I'm looking for comfort foods." At The Greek in New York City, he likes to order the juicy grilled lamb chops or a piping-hot skillet of shrimp and tangy feta cheese called Garides Saganaki (pictured above). The tender shrimp are quickly seared with serrano peppers and roasted garlic, then blanketed with Greek cheeses, which turn bubbly after a quick bake in the oven.

Puckett's Grocery & Restaurant

"It's exactly the type of food I want to eat," Chef Michael Psilakis notes of the menu at Puckett's Grocery in Nashville. For him, that means a pork-pancake breakfast stack and a platter of meatloaf and mashed potatoes (pictured above). Made with a blend of beef and pork, plus bold spices and breadcrumbs, this slowly smoked meatloaf is served with simple sauteed veggies and, of course, creamy mashed potatoes. "This is the place that defines meatloaf and mashd potatoes," he declares.
